What is the electronic signature legitimacy for shipping in the United Kingdom
The electronic signature legitimacy for shipping in the United Kingdom refers to the legal recognition of electronic signatures in shipping documents. Under UK law, electronic signatures are considered valid and enforceable, provided they meet certain criteria outlined in the Electronic Communications Act 2000 and subsequent regulations. This means that businesses can utilize electronic signatures for contracts, shipping agreements, and other related documents without the need for physical signatures, streamlining the shipping process.

Legal use of the electronic signature legitimacy for shipping in the United Kingdom
The legal use of electronic signatures in shipping documents is supported by legislation that recognizes their validity. Businesses must ensure that the electronic signature process complies with the requirements set forth in the Electronic Communications Act and the EU’s eIDAS Regulation. This includes ensuring that the signers have consented to use electronic signatures and that the signatures are linked to the signers in a way that allows for verification. By adhering to these legal standards, businesses can confidently use electronic signatures in their shipping processes.
Security & Compliance Guidelines
When using electronic signatures for shipping, security and compliance are paramount. Businesses should implement robust security measures, including encryption and secure access controls, to protect sensitive information. It is also essential to maintain an audit trail of all signed documents, which can provide proof of consent and the integrity of the signed content. Compliance with relevant regulations, such as GDPR for data protection, further enhances the legitimacy and security of electronic signatures in shipping.
Documents You Can Sign
Various shipping-related documents can be signed electronically, including:
- Shipping contracts
- Bill of lading
- Delivery receipts
- Customs declarations
- Insurance forms
Using electronic signatures on these documents not only expedites the shipping process but also ensures that all parties have access to a legally binding record of the agreement.
